Arthrology is the science concerned with the study of the anatomy, function, dysfunction and treatment of joints and articulations.
[1] The prefix "arthro-" refers to joints, as in arthrogram, arthroscopy, or arthritis, from the Greek ἄρθρον arthron.
Arthrology is also referred to as arthrologia, syndesmologia, syndesmology, and synosteology.
[2] Specialists in this field are known as arthrologists.
